What powers those pistons up and down are thousands of tiny controlled explosions occurring every minute, created by mixing fuel with oxygen and igniting the combination. Each time the gasoline ignites is known as the combustion, or power, stroke. The warmth and expanding gases from this miniexplosion push the piston down in the cylinder. The cylinder head is a bit of metallic that sits over the engine’s cylinders. There are small, rounded indentations forged into the cylinder head in order to create room at the top of the chamber for combustion.
